Stretching Apparatus
Abstract
The invention relates to a stretching apparatus which is used to stretch the posterior muscles and tendons by means of powered stretching movements. The apparatus comprises a body ( 102 ), a seat area ( 101 ) a moveable handle grip ( 111 ) and foot pedals ( 105 ). In use grips ( 111 ) are moved forward whilst the user keeps his or her legs straight. That movement stretches some of the posterior muscles (including the back and buttock muscles). Further movement of the foot pedals 105 toward the user stretches his or her upper and lower leg muscles. The stretching movements could be mechanical, e.g. spring or worm screw actuated, or other power could be used. Electronic control ( 120 ) of the apparatus is described.

A stretching apparatus for stretching the posterior muscles and tendons by means of powered stretching movements of the apparatus, the apparatus comprising a body having a seat area, at least one powered foot pedal mounted to the body and arranged with the seat area for generally straight-legged sitting of a user, and a powered handle mounted to the body and arranged for pulling the user forwardly to cause the powered stretching movements.
2 . Stretching apparatus as claimed in claim 1 , wherein is adapted such that the handle is powered for pulling the user forward for stretching movements and the foot pedal is powered for movement in substantially the opposition direction for further stretching movements.
3 . Stretching apparatus as claimed in claim 2 wherein the handle is moved first followed by the foot pedal.
4 . Stretching apparatus as claimed in claim 3 wherein, the handle includes hand grips.
5 . Stretching apparatus as claimed in claim 4 wherein, the grips are moveable generally away from the seat area and toward the foot pedal for causing stretching of the posterior muscles and tendons.
6 . Stretching apparatus as claimed in claim 4 wherein, the grips include a pair of grips with adjustable relative positions.
7 . Stretching apparatus as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the foot pedal(s) are moveable generally to cause toes of the feet of the user to move back toward the seat area while legs of the user are generally straight.
8 . Stretching apparatus as claimed in claim 7 wherein, the pedals are pivotable on the body.
9 . Stretching apparatus as claimed in claim 6 , wherein the height of the grips is adjustable relative to the seat area.
10 . Stretching apparatus as claimed in claim 1 wherein the stretching movements are caused by stored mechanical energy.
11 . Stretching apparatus as claimed in claim 1 wherein, the stretching movements are caused by one or more of electrically, pneumatically or hydraulically powered actuators.
12 . Stretching apparatus as claimed in claim 1 wherein, the stretching movements are caused by mechanical energy produced by the user.
13 . Stretching apparatus as claimed in claim 1 wherein, the apparatus includes mechanical stops and/or sensors operable to predefine the limit of the extent the stretching movements.
14 . Stretching apparatus as claimed in claim 1 further including stretching movement dampers or other control of stretching movements to restrict the velocity of the movements.
15 . Stretching apparatus as claimed in claim 14 wherein, the damping or other control of release movements in the opposite direction to the stretching movements is provided.
16 . Stretching apparatus as claimed in claim 1 wherein, the stretching movements to a first extent are followed by release movements in the opposite direction to the stretching movements, in turn followed by further stretching movements to a second extent of a greater distance than the first extent, followed by further release movements, and optionally further stretching movements with increasing extent, until a predefined extent has been obtained, each of the stretching movements being followed by further release movements.
17 . Stretching apparatus as claimed in claim 4 wherein the grips are pivotable and thereby provide means for stretching the muscle and tendons associated with arm stretching.
